NAME
tapset::ioblock - systemtap ioblock tapset
DESCRIPTION
- ioblock.request
-
Fires whenever making a generic block I/O request.
-
See
probe::ioblock.request(3stap)
for details.
- ioblock.end
-
Fires whenever a block I/O transfer is complete.
-
See
probe::ioblock.end(3stap)
for details.
- ioblock_trace.bounce
-
Fires whenever a buffer bounce is needed for at least one page of a block IO request.
-
See
probe::ioblock_trace.bounce(3stap)
for details.
- ioblock_trace.request
-
Fires just as a generic block I/O request is created for a bio.
-
See
probe::ioblock_trace.request(3stap)
for details.
- ioblock_trace.end
-
Fires whenever a block I/O transfer is complete.
-
See
probe::ioblock_trace.end(3stap)
for details.
